NHTSA safety recall
Recall 74V209000: SERVICE BRAKES, AIR:SUPPLY:HOSES, LINES/PIPING, AND FITTINGS
BLUE BIRD BODY COMPANY · Reported to NHTSA Nov 6, 1974

Notes
BLUE BIRD CAMPAIGN NO N/A.FORWARD CONTROL.POSSIBILITY THAT FERRULE FITTINGSON COPPER TUBING TO REAR AIR BRAKE CHAMBERS MAY HAVE BEEN OVERTIGHTENED.IFTHIS OCCURS IT WOULD CAUSE TUBING TO BE TWISTED AND OVERSTRESSED AND MAY LEADTO FAILURE WHERE TUBE ATTACHES TO BRAKE CHAMBER.(CORRECT BY INSPECTING ANDMODIFYING WITH REPAIR KITS).
